| We celebrated our centenary
in 2006. It was a very special year. It started with a Gala
Ball at Redditch Town Hall where we had over 100 past and present
members in attendance. During the proceedings two fifty year
NODA awards were presented along with others ranging from 10
to 45 years.
Our next event was the exceptional production of ‘
My Fair Lady’ at the newly refurbished Palace Theatre.
The dress rehearsal fell on the exact day of the first 1906
production and a special Anniversary cake was made y Paul
Rea one of the society’s members. The set was constructed
by our scenery team and was said to be as good as any ‘west
end’ set, it was even electrically operated moving up
and down stage.
This was followed by a ‘Ascot’ race evening ,
and the annual Bar-B-Q in a members garden. Which were both
well supported.
The year was rounded off with another Celebration Dinner
at the Redditch Town Hall this time around 70 gathered to
witness the presentation of a digital camera and printer to
the retiring President Joe Brennan by Pearl Taylor the new
President. The Chairman presented a Dovecote to the retiring
Secretary Shirley Nash who had served for five years.
It was deemed a fitting end to an exceptional year in the
society’s history.
